Creamy Mushroom Chicken

Golden pan-fried chicken in a rich, garlicky mushroom cream sauce, ready in under 30 minutes.

Ingredients

For 2 servings

  • chicken breasts2
  • salt and pepperto taste
  • olive oil1 tbsp
  • butter20 g
  • chestnut mushrooms, sliced150 g
  • garlic cloves, crushed2
  • chicken stock150 ml
  • double cream100 ml
  • Dijon mustard1 tsp
  • fresh parsley, choppedto serve

Method

  1. 1

    Season the chicken breasts with salt and pepper.

  2. 2

    Heat the olive oil in a large frying pan over medium heat. Add the chicken and cook for 6 to 7 minutes on each side, until golden and cooked through with no pink in the middle. Remove and set aside on a plate.

  3. 3

    Add the butter to the same pan and let it melt. Add the mushrooms and cook for 5 to 6 minutes, stirring occasionally, until softened and any liquid they release has mostly cooked away.

  4. 4

    Add the garlic and cook for 30 seconds until fragrant.

  5. 5

    Pour in the chicken stock, scraping up any browned bits stuck to the bottom of the pan.

  6. 6

    Stir in the cream and Dijon mustard. Simmer for 3 to 4 minutes until the sauce thickens slightly.

  7. 7

    Return the chicken to the pan, spoon the sauce over the top, and warm through for 2 minutes.

  8. 8

    Scatter with fresh parsley before serving.
